The Open vSwitch project is participating in Open Source Days at OpenStack Summit Boston. During the summit, Open vSwitch will have dedicated use of a room for a full day. We are seeking participation for talks and tutorials for this event. OpenStack Summit Boston will be held May 8 to 11. We do not yet know which day the Open Source Days event will be held. Talks ----- We are seeking talks on topics including the following: * Deploying and using OVN. * End-user or service provider experiences with OVN or Open vSwitch. * Testing and scaling OVN. * Troubleshooting and debugging Open vSwitch or OVN installations. * Using Open vSwitch or OVN with OpenStack. * Container integration with Open vSwitch or OVN, including usage with container orchestration systems such as Kubernetes and Mesos. * Using OVN to realize NFV and service chaining. * Integrating OVN with Linux distributions, with Windows, or other operating systems. * Open vSwitch relationship with other open source projects. * Increasing the size and diversity of the Open vSwitch user and developer base. * Demos. * Other topics likely to be of interest to attendees. We expect most talks to last 20 minutes, with added time for questions. We are also open to requests for longer or shorter time blocks.
